C4ISR
 n.β€” Β«China is building more missiles and also appears to be focusing on depriving either side’s defenses from finding its missiles and thus concentrates on attacking their command, control, communications,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ance capabilities (C4ISR in military parlance) while also moving to join the other two governments in weaponizing space.Β» β€”β€œSpinning the nuclear missile wheel” by Stephen Blank Asia Times (Hong Kong) May 5, 2004.
